Following the curved arrows, draw a resonance structure for the \text{HCONH}^– ion.
Strategy Move electron pairs as indicated by the curved arrows, and calculate formal charges to reposition the negative charge.
Setup To determine the formal charge, we must first calculate the number of valence electrons on the atoms in question. The \text{O} and \text{N} atoms have six and five valence electrons, respectively.

Repositioning electron pairs as directed by the curved arrows gives
The formal charge on \text{N}, which had been –1, is now [5 – (3 + 2)] = 0. The formal charge^* on \text{O}, which had been 0, is now [6 – (1 + 6)] = –1. Thus, the negative charge now resides on the oxygen atom.
^*Student Annotation: Recall that formal charge is equal to valence electrons − associated electrons [≪ Section 6.4]
